Vestavia Hills Zoning Ordinance Β§4.5 (Fences) requires all fences in residential districts to be set back behind the front building line. Fences between the building line and front setback must be open and ornamental (no chain link or privacy wood). Security fences in front yards require lots with 100+ ft from lot line to house.
In all residential zoning districts, fences must be set back behind the front building line or behind the minimum front yard setback of an abutting residential property, whichever is greater. Between the building line and front setback, only open ornamental fences finished on both sides are permitted β chain link and privacy wood fencing are excluded. Security fences in front yards require lots where the principal structure is at least 100 feet from the front lot line, and must be stone, masonry, or metal, set 2 ft inside the lot line or 5 ft from public improvements.
Non-compliant fence: written notice, 30-day correction. $100 per day after deadline.
